Paella in the back yard - great for easily feeding a larger team


ree

If you're planning a team offsite and want an easy, delicious way to feed a group, but you don't want the expense of a private chef, we recommend bringing a paella vendor in. We've done this, and it's a great way to feed a team and have them enjoy the cooking experience in the process.


The paella vendor will typically set up a few hours ahead of time and cook the paella on-site. This setup works very well in our back yard or on our dock (assuming the weather is warm enough, which it easily is between March - September). You can also have the vendor set up on the deck and eat inside if the weather is too cool (although we also have patio heat lamps for the dock).

TruffleShuffle: A virtual (i.e., over Zoom) group cooking experience with your team

You wouldn't think that a virtual Zoom cooking class would be much fun, but chef Jason really creates amazing experiences for in-person or distributed teams.


His company, TruffleShuffle, does both fully live in-person group cooking events, as well as remote Zoom cooking events. For the remote events, the company will send a"cooking box" of ingredients to your team's home ahead of time. You can also have your team be all together in person, and have Chef Jason on Zoom.

Chris Sams - An incredible day or evening of improv for your colleagues or family

The power of Improv:


Chris Sams puts on an incredible improv session, which FounderCulture Founders have done live in person at the Lagoon Retreat, but which Chris has also done virtually over Zoom.

💡You can book Chris via his "Connecting Through Improv" Airbnb experience page or reach out to DROdio if you'd like his direct phone number for larger events.

The improv is not only a really fun group connecting activity, but it's also an opportunity to bring really helpful and important themes into your company, including:

  • The concept of extending ideas via Yes, And… instead of saying "no" to ideas.

  • Ways to collaborate together
